Key Responsibilities

  • •Develop and implement procurement strategies for IT categories (IT Services, HW & Telco) in alignment with business objectives.
  • •Conduct market analysis to identify suppliers and assess market trends for strategic alignment.
  • •Evaluate, select, and manage suppliers; conduct performance reviews to ensure service continuity and mitigate supplier risks.
  • •Lead contract negotiations with Allianz competence centers, manage contract documentation, and ensure legal/regulatory compliance.
  • •Identify and drive cost-saving initiatives through procurement performance tracking, best practices, and risk/contingency planning for disruptions.

Key Requirements

  • •Develop and execute IT procurement strategies aligned with business objectives.
  • •Lead supplier evaluation, selection, and performance reviews based on service quality, cost, and reliability.
  • •Strong contract management and negotiation skills to secure favorable terms and ensure compliance.
  • •Analyze spend data and market trends to drive problem-solving, pragmatic recommendations, and cost-saving initiatives.
  • •Proficiency with procurement tools and systems (SAP MM, Ariba) plus Microsoft Office; 7–10 years in procurement and a relevant bachelor’s degree (Master’s advantageous).
